[MPlayer-cvslog] r31015 - trunk/libvo/vo_corevideo.m

Reimar Döffinger Reimar.Doeffinger at gmx.de
Mon Apr 5 18:55:10 CEST 2010

On Mon, Apr 05, 2010 at 12:30:37PM -0400, Alexander Strange wrote:
> I mean to merge the two sometime - gl is 70%(!) faster than corevideo for me.

You have my full support for that - I've done some work to make -vo gl quite
independent from the "backend" but I lack understanding of the OSX API
and I can't think of a really good way to combine C and Objective C code in
order to actually get it done anytime soon.
(I only request that if you think you need to do modifications to gl_common
you maybe discuss that first with me).

> BTW the coreaudio AO is fine as far as I know, although it does seem to use the system resampler instead of mplayer's.

Depends on how you define "fine".
For AC3-passthrough it waits for the result of AudioStreamSetProperty in an
indeterministic way, which I suspect is either the cause or hides the cause
for the issue described here:

